Postby HoovesUp! » 02 Aug 2012 17:52

Most of my sequencing comes out of Logic Pro 9. Sample chopping and glitchiness comes out of the best program built for that (IMHO): Ableton Live 8 Suite. I have an army of third-party plugins (currently numbering just short of 600), and Reason 5 is basically in there just for how awesome Thor and Kong are. I also use MaxMSP for some more complex sound design/effect-building, as well as AudioMulch for messing with premade loops in a live setting. I tried Renoise for a while, too. I hated it. Wave editing and mastering happens in Adobe Audition CS6, and any actual musical notation is done in Sibelius 7. As for actual synth plugins, I have a weakness for old monaural SoundFonts I can modify to the point of becoming unrecognizable, as well as Sylenth1, NI Massive, reFX Nexus and Vanguard, and NI Reaktor 5 for building my own synths in Logic, where MaxMSP has no home.
